The 18th annual Ed Kuntz Memorial Golf Tournament was held June 16 at Great Life Golf and Fitness in Abilene. Fifteen teams participated with challenges and prizes awarded for every hole. Cash prizes were awarded to the top three teams in each flight. Kelly Sellers, Gunnar Anderson, Mark Picking, and Dalton Shaffett were the overall winners. They had a winning score of 55.

The winner of this year’s “Golf Ball Drop” was Brad Berry. A total of 304 golf balls were dropped this year and Berry’s ball made it closest to the hole. The total raised from the ball drop was $1520, of which the winner received $599. The winner of the raffle was Harold Courtois.

Hospice of Dickinson County is a local non-profit organization that accepts all hospice patients that meet criteria regardless of ability to pay. This golf tournament is spearheaded by the Ed Kuntz family and the proceeds are donated to Hospice of Dickinson County for Hospice patient services.
